2012年6月7日木曜日

開発環境

『Learning Ruby』(Michael Fitzgerald 著、O'Reilly Media、2007年、ISBN978-0-596-52986-4)の Chapter 2(Conditional Love)Review Questions 8を解いてみる。

その他参考書籍

8.

必ず1回はブロック内の処理が実行される。他の言語(C#とか)のdo/whileループみたいなもの。

コード(TextWrangler)

#!/usr/bin/env ruby
# -*- coding: utf-8 -*-

n = 10
puts 'whileループ開始'
while n < 10
  puts n
  n += 1
end
puts 'whileループ終了'

m = 10
puts 'begin/end, whileループ開始'
begin
  puts m
  m += 1
end while m < 10
puts 'begin/end, whileループ終了'

入出力結果(Terminal)

$ ruby sample.rb
whileループ開始
whileループ終了
begin/end, whileループ開始
10
begin/end, whileループ終了
$

0 コメント:

コメントを投稿